What You Will Learn
During this presentation, you will learn about the different types of scrapbooks and where they can be located. We will also explore the varieties of records found in scrapbooks and why they are important to genealogy research.
Speaker
Melissa Barker is a Certified Archives Manager and Public Historian currently working at the Houston County, Tennessee Archives & Museum. She is affectionally known as The Archive Lady to the genealogy community. She lectures, teaches, and writes about the genealogy research process, researching in archives and records preservation. She conducts virtual presentations across the United States and other countries for various genealogy groups and societies. She writes a popular blog entitled A Genealogist in the Archives and is a well-known published book reviewer. She has been a Professional Genealogist for the past 21 years with expertise in Tennessee records. She has been researching her own family history for the past 35 years.
